How to Make Chicken Burrito Bowl Recipe

Step 1: Marinate the Chicken

Begin by whisking together olive oil, fresh lime juice, paprika, cumin, chili powder, garlic powder, onion powder, oregano, salt, and pepper in a bowl. This marinade is your flavor powerhouse, infusing the chicken with smoky, zesty notes that make it irresistible. Add the chicken breasts, making sure they are completely coated, then cover and let them soak up all that goodness for at least 30 minutes—or up to 2 hours if you can plan ahead.

Step 2: Cook the Chicken

Once marinated, grill or pan-sear the chicken over medium heat. You’re aiming for a golden crust with those spices caramelized just right—about 6 to 8 minutes per side. Cooking it this way locks in the juices and ensures your chicken is tender and flavorful. Let it rest a few minutes before slicing into thin strips, which makes it perfect for layering into your burrito bowl.

Step 3: Prepare the Base

While your chicken is cooking, divide the cooked brown rice and fresh mixed greens evenly between two bowls. The brown rice provides a nutty, chewy backdrop that contrasts beautifully with the crisp greens, creating a balanced textural base for your vibrant toppings.

Step 4: Add the Toppings

Now for the fun part—layer the sliced chicken across the bowls, then pile on black beans, corn, quartered cherry tomatoes, creamy avocado slices, diced red onion, and sliced jalapeño. Each ingredient contributes its own punch of flavor and texture, making every bite exciting and satisfying.

Step 5: Finish with Lime Juice and Greek Yogurt

Drizzle an extra tablespoon of fresh lime juice over the assembled bowls to add that fresh citrus brightness that cuts through the richness. Then dollop a generous spoonful of Greek yogurt on top to cool and complement the spicy notes while adding a luscious creaminess you will love.

Step 6: Season and Garnish

Lastly, season with sea salt and freshly ground pepper to taste, and sprinkle with a small handful of chopped cilantro for an herbaceous finish. Don’t skip the cilantro garnish—it’s the aromatic crown that brings everything together and makes this Chicken Burrito Bowl Recipe truly irresistible.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Store any leftover chicken and rice separately from the fresh toppings in airtight containers in the refrigerator. This helps maintain the texture and prevents the greens from wilting or the avocado from browning too quickly.

Freezing

The cooked chicken and rice components of this Chicken Burrito Bowl Recipe freeze beautifully. Pack them in freezer-safe containers or bags for up to three months. Avoid freezing fresh vegetables and avocado, as they do not reheat well.

Reheating

When ready to enjoy your leftovers, thaw frozen portions overnight in the fridge if used. Reheat the chicken and rice gently in the microwave or on the stovetop until warm, then top with fresh, cold ingredients like avocado slices, jalapeño, and a dollop of Greek yogurt for that fresh-made feel.

FAQs

Can I use chicken thighs instead of chicken breasts?

Absolutely! Chicken thighs are juicier and have more flavor but may require slightly longer cooking times. Just marinate and cook until they reach an internal temperature of 165°F for best results.

Is it possible to make this recipe vegetarian?

Yes! Swap the chicken for grilled tofu, tempeh, or simply add more beans and veggies like roasted sweet potatoes or sautéed mushrooms for a satisfying meatless version.

What can I substitute for Greek yogurt?

If Greek yogurt isn’t available or desired, sour cream is a classic alternative. For a vegan option, try a dollop of cashew cream or a plant-based yogurt.

How spicy is this bowl with jalapeño included?

The jalapeño adds a fresh, mild to moderate heat that can be toned down by removing seeds or omitted entirely if you prefer a milder dish.

Can I prepare this bowl entirely ahead of time for meal prep?

Yes, just keep components like avocado, jalapeño, and yogurt separate until ready to serve to maintain freshness and texture. The chicken and rice are perfect for making ahead and storing for several days.

Ingredients

Chicken Marinade

  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on fresh lime juice
  • ½ teaspoon paprika
  • ½ teaspoon ground cumin
  • ¼ teaspoon chili powder
  • ¼ teaspoon garlic powder
  • ¼ teaspoon onion powder
  • ¼ teaspoon dried oregano
  • Pinch of salt and pepper, or to taste
  • 2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ts

Bowl Ingredients

  • 1 cup cooked brown rice
  • 1 tablespoon lime juice
  • 1 small avocado, sliced
  • 2 cups mixed greens
  • ½ cup black beans
  • ½ cup canned corn, drained or grilled
  • â…“ cup cherry tomatoes, quartered
  • 2 tablespoons Greek yogurt
  • ½ red onion, diced
  • 1 jalapeño pepper, sliced
  • Sea salt and freshly ground black pepper, to taste
  • Small handful of chopped cilantro, plus more for garnish


Instructions

  1. Marinate the Chicken: In a bowl, mix all the chicken marinade ingredients including olive oil, lime juice, and spices. Add the chicken breasts and coat them thoroughly with the marinade. Cover and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es, preferably up to 2 hours to enhance flavor.
  2. Cook the Chicken: Grill or pan-sear the marinated chicken over medium heat for 6–8 minutes per side, or until the internal temperature reaches 165°F and the chicken is cooked through. Once done, let it rest for a few minutes before slicing thinly.
  3. Prepare the Bowls: Divide the cooked brown rice and mixed greens evenly between serving bowls as the base layers for the burrito bowls.
  4. Add Toppings: Top each bowl with the sliced grilled chicken, black beans, corn, cherry tomatoes, sliced avocado, diced red onion, and sliced jalapeño pepper for a mix of texture and flavor.
  5. Garnish and Finish: Drizzle the lime juice over the bowls, then add a dollop of Greek yogurt on top for creaminess. Season with sea salt, freshly ground black pepper, and sprinkle chopped cilantro. Garnish with extra cilantro for a fresh finish before serving.

Notes

  • Marinating the chicken for a longer time enhances the flavor and tenderness.
  • You can substitute brown rice with quinoa or cauliflower rice for a different texture or dietary preference.
  • Grilling gives a smoky flavor but pan-searing is a great indoor alternative.
  • Adjust jalapeño quantity based on your heat preference or omit for a milder version.
  • Greek yogurt adds creaminess; sour cream or a dairy-free alternative can also be used.
